According to a report by the Sporting News, the Jets are considering trading linebacker Eric Barton and cornerback David Barrett on draft day. In addition to those two, the Jets are also looking to trade wide receiver Justin McCareins for at least a fourth round draft pick.While none of the three carry any great value, the Jets may be able to package them and their first round pick to move up. They have an eye on some of the first round cornerbacks but realize most, if not all, will be gone by pick 25.
It's almost a certainty that McCareins would command the biggest return and would likely be the centerpiece of a potential first round swap. There is a good chance that Darrelle Revis could be available at pick number 20, someone the Jets would love to draft. With the Giants possibly wanting to trade down and their need for a wide receiver, they could be an ideal trade partner. I may be reaching a bit, but it's just a thought.
